What we look for in a Sous Chef:
- We are looking for an existing Sous Chef or Senior CDP looking for their next step, who considers themselves a natural leader with a passion and flare for producing quality fresh food in an environment that makes people feel welcome.
- Have experience championing excellent service through quality food
- Demonstrate a passion for leading and developing a team
- Be an active hands-on Chef with excellent communication skills
- Be responsible and able to manage the kitchen staff rota, training and all health and safety effectively always
- Working alongside your Head Chef, you will be able to demonstrate your creativity and ability by helping to design and deliver new dishes for our menus and daily specials
- Demonstrate great planning and organisational skills, necessary to maintain effective controls regarding both GP and labour
- Have a proactive approach to driving sales and delivering growth, through engagement with both kitchen and front-of-house teams

How to prepare for a job interview at Young's
✨Know Your Ingredients
Familiarise yourself with the menu and the types of dishes the establishment serves. Be ready to discuss how you can contribute creatively to their offerings, showcasing your passion for fresh food and quality service.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ully led a team in the kitchen. Highlight your experience in training staff and managing rotas, as well as how you handle challenges in a busy environment.
✨Communicate Clearly
Practice articulating your thoughts on kitchen management and teamwork. Good communication is key, so be prepared to discuss how you ensure everyone is on the same page, especially when it comes to health and safety standards.
✨Demonstrate Your Passion
Let your enthusiasm for cooking and creating new dishes shine through. Share stories about your culinary journey and what drives you to excel in the kitchen, making sure to connect it back to the values of Young’s.
